Freezing temps alone do not guarantee great ice. That's my unsolicited "professional" opinion as a self-proclaimed ice judge. We finally hit freezing temperatures around here so I went for a walk with the hopes of finding a bit of ice since everything is bare and brown around here (snow coming tonight though). I found what I hoped for, and this is one of the shots I came home with. This is a color photo, but the ice was mostly sheltered from much light. The light that did hit it reflected beautifully.
Image photographed in Massachusetts.
I grew up in Kansas, just outside of Kansas City, and while some might find the endless rolling plains to be boring, I love the open space and fantastic sunsets. I have since lived in Minnesota, Rhode Island (briefly), New Hampshire, and now reside in Massachusetts. Most of my photos were taken in New England. I started taking pictures around the age of 10, borrowing my dad's point and shoot to document my adventures during a trip to Colorado with close family friends. My love of animals and all of God's creation has inspired me ever since. There are so many details to discover outdoors, from bees collecting nectar to the great expanse of mountains and oceans.
